MMA’s Great Debate Radio: Frankie Edgar, Conor McGregor and UFC 165 Review
MMA's Great Debate Radio returns for Tuesday's show with former UFC lightweight champion Frankie Edgar and featherweight star Conor McGregor. Edgar joins us today to discuss his decision to accept a coaching spot on the new season of The Ultimate Fighter opposite BJ Penn. He will also explain why he was willing to face Penn for a third time after already holding two wins over him in previous fights. Also on the show, Irish featherweight Conor McGregor updates us on his injured knee and the surgery he had to repair the damage. He will also talk about a recent meeting with UFC welterweight champion Georges St-Pierre, while also sending a warning to the rest of the 145-pound division. Finally the debate today circles around the events of last weekend's UFC 165 card from Toronto including the epic main event between Jon Jones and Alexander Gustafsson. MMA’s Great Debate Radio: Roundtable Discussion About Chris Weidman vs. Anderson Silva
It's less than 48 hours since Chris Weidman knocked out Anderson Silva in one of the biggest moments in MMA history, and on today's show we will debate all of the fallout from the fight over the weekend. Chris Weidman managed to do in less than two rounds what no other fighter in the UFC could do in 16 fights, plus he was the first ever to knockout the legendary Brazilian champion. Heavy is the head that wears the crown, so today we will discuss Chris Weidman's win along with the prospects about his first title defense. Today's show will also discuss the antics that caught up to Anderson Silva on Saturday night. Did his showboating finally cost him or was this what made Silva so great during his undefeated run through the UFC? All this and much, much more as we turn our entire focus to the championship bout between Chris Weidman and Anderson Silva.
